DASU hydropower project launch landmark dam foundation pit excavation works

2 min read

ISLAMABAD (Internews): The DASU Hydro-power Project has commenced the excavation of the dam foundation pit, marking a critical phase in the construction of this major water conservancy hub

According to a statement released by Energy China on Wednesday, this marks a crucial phase in the development of one of the country’s major water conservancy projects.

The excavation works, which span from an elevation of 715.0 meters to 776.0 meters, are expected to involve a total excavation volume of over 1.22 million cubic meters.

The project team has already overcome significant challenges, including a devastating mudslide in 2022. By optimizing geological surveys and engineering designs, they have successfully implemented a stepped excavation plan, ensuring smooth progress.

Once completed, the DASU Hydro-power Station will have an installed capacity of 5400 MW, which is expected to play a pivotal role in addressing Pakistan’s ongoing power shortages.

In addition to providing sustainable energy, the project is anticipated to generate over 8,000 jobs, support local industries, and stimulate regional economic growth.

Moreover, the project will contribute to Pakistan’s green energy transformation, promoting a more environmentally sustainable energy future.
